试用的DB2版本通常时间为90天,试用期事后数据库变没法正常打开,提示信息为数据库已过时,为了继续试用,有几种解决方式供你们参考: html
1.简单直接的方法——修改linux系统日期,让DB2获取当前日期在过时时间以前; linux
命令:date 040517102013 或者 date -s "17:10:00 2013-04-05" (比较灵活,请参考date命令大全) 数据库
备注:在修改完后,须要执行命令hwclock或者clock将当前时间保存到系统时间;这是由于在Linux中有硬件时钟与系统时钟等两种时钟。硬件时钟是指主机板上的时钟设备,也就是一般可在BIOS 画面设定的时钟。系统时钟则是指kernel中的时钟。当Linux启动时,系统时钟会去读取硬件时钟的设定,以后系统时钟即独立运做。全部Linux相关指令与函数都是读取系统时钟的设定。 jsp
2.使用db2licm命令为DB2安装许可证 函数
操做方法: 学习
1>将文件db2ese_c.lic上传到到linux某一目录,如/opt/ibm/db2/V9.7/license spa
2>添加license:db2licm -a /opt/ibm/db2/V9.7/license/db2ese_c .lic .net
3>执行后显示:LIC1402I License added successfully,再用db2licm -l查看,你会发现你的db2变为永久了; server
备注:db2licm命令提供了添加、移除、列示和修改本地系统上安装的许可证功能 htm
命令选项详解:
-a 添加产品的许可证。
-l 列示具备可用许可证信息的全部产品。
-r 除去产品的许可证。除去许可证以后,产品就以“先试后买”方式运做。要获取特定产品的密码,使用 -l 选项调用命令。
-v 显示版本信息。
3.申请DB2许可证
须要向下载CD映像病激活,具体参考 获取DB2许可证,这种方式须要付费
最后附上一篇关于date试用的文章http://521cto.blog.51cto.com/950229/935642/和db2ese_c.lic,见附件。
请你们关注个人微博@varick-GO 共同窗习